using Connection_Patcher.Constants;
|
|
using System;
|
|
using System.IO;
|
|
using System.Security.Cryptography;
|
|
|
|
namespace Connection_Patcher
|
|
{
|
|
class Helper
|
|
{
|
|
public static BinaryTypes GetBinaryType(byte[] data)
|
|
{
|
|
BinaryTypes type = 0u;
|
|
|
|
using (var reader = new BinaryReader(new MemoryStream(data)))
|
|
{
|
|
var magic = (uint)reader.ReadUInt16();
|
|
|
|
// Check MS-DOS magic
|
|
if (magic == 0x5A4D)
|
|
{
|
|
reader.BaseStream.Seek(0x3C, SeekOrigin.Begin);
|
|
|
|
// Read PE start offset
|
|
var peOffset = reader.ReadUInt32();
|
|
|
|
reader.BaseStream.Seek(peOffset, SeekOrigin.Begin);
|
|
|
|
var peMagic = reader.ReadUInt32();
|
|
|
|
// Check PE magic
|
|
if (peMagic != 0x4550)
|
|
throw new NotSupportedException("Not a PE file!");
|
|
|
|
type = (BinaryTypes)reader.ReadUInt16();
|
|
}
|
|
else
|
|
{
|
|
reader.BaseStream.Seek(0, SeekOrigin.Begin);
|
|
|
|
type = (BinaryTypes)reader.ReadUInt32();
|
|
}
|
|
}
|
|
|
|
return type;
|
|
}
|
|
|
|
public static string GetFileChecksum(byte[] data)
|
|
{
|
|
using (var stream = new BufferedStream(new MemoryStream(data), 1200000))
|
|
{
|
|
var sha256 = new SHA256Managed();
|
|
var checksum = sha256.ComputeHash(stream);
|
|
|
|
return BitConverter.ToString(checksum).Replace("-", "").ToLower();
|
|
}
|
|
}
|
|
}
|
|
}
